Event name:  Alternative Career Choices for Engineers & Technical Professionals III
Sponsor:  Engineering Society of Detroit
Date:  Wednesday, June 17, 2009
Time:  8:00 a.m. – 11:30 a.m. (Registration begins at 7:30 a.m.)
Location:  Rock Financial Showcase, 46100 Grand River, Novi
Cost:  $30 ESD members,  $35 nonmembers (includes continental breakfast)
Contact:  Sue Ruffner, 248/353-0735 or sruffner@esd.org 

Event description: 
The Engineering Society of Detroit will present the third session in a series designed to provide engineers and technical professionals with information on transitioning into alternative careers. This third program will focus on various individuals who have made successful career changes and the lessons they learned throughout the transition process.  Come hear real-life stories from many professionals covering a wide range of career experiences. Learn how they successfully managed to transition their skills into a new field and how their unique experiences can benefit you. Also learn how to effectively deal with the emotional process of being in between successes from twoprofessional coaches.
